Welcome back to another week! Today, teams collected their materials and started building! There are a few design requirements:

 

  1. The houses can be no larger than 10x10cm.
  2. The house must have a door.

 

Beyond those, the designs are up to each group. Unused building materials can be exchanged for money or other items, and several groups made changes to their initial designs on paper once they’d started building the real thing. The most common building materials in each class were construction paper and cardboard, with the least popular being cotton. Those reading this will get a little hint, since cotton is actually a great material to use. It mimics the way we insulate our houses in real life when it’s spread out to cover a larger portion of the house. Tomorrow, we’ll start testing prototypes.
